Saskara Population - Pashchimi Singhbhum, Jharkhand

Saskara is a medium size village located in Sonua Block of Pashchimi Singhbhum district, Jharkhand with total 252 families residing. The Saskara village has population of 1034 of which 516 are males while 518 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Saskara village population of children with age 0-6 is 136 which makes up 13.15 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Saskara village is 1004 which is higher than Jharkhand state average of 948. Child Sex Ratio for the Saskara as per census is 1030, higher than Jharkhand average of 948.

Saskara village has lower literacy rate compared to Jharkhand. In 2011, literacy rate of Saskara village was 65.59 % compared to 66.41 % of Jharkhand. In Saskara Male literacy stands at 82.63 % while female literacy rate was 48.55 %.

Caste Factor

Saskara village of Pashchimi Singhbhum has substantial population of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 31.43 % while Schedule Caste (SC) were 6.29 % of total population in Saskara village.

Work Profile

In Saskara village out of total population, 596 were engaged in work activities. 38.93 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 61.07 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 596 workers engaged in Main Work, 132 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 14 were Agricultural labourer.
